Former Penn State DE Shaka Toney Makes Washington’s 53-Man Roster

Shaka Toney entered the Washington football training camp as a long shot to make the opening roster.

The percentage of seventh round picks that stick on the 53-man roster though out the NFL isn’t high. However, that didn’t stop Toney from working to achieve his goal and today he reportedly received the news that he beat those odds and will be a member of Ron Rivera’s defensive line in Washington.

The 6’2″, 238 pound defensive end from Penn State will start his NFL career backing up arguably the best defensive end duo in the league in Chase Young and Montez Sweat. The word out of Washington is that Toney impressed the coaches with his quickness off the edge along with being a bigger guy that can run and contribute in a lot of special team roles.
